Subject: [PATCH -next] phy: marvell: phy-mvebu-cp11i-utmi needs USB_COMMON
Date: Thu,  1 Apr 2021 14:00:45 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210401210045.23525-1-rdunlap@infradead.org> (raw)

When USB and USB_COMMON are not enabled, phy-mvebu-cp110-utmi
suffers a build error due to a missing interface that is provided
by CONFIG_USB_COMMON, so make the driver depend on USB_COMMON.

ld: drivers/phy/marvell/phy-mvebu-cp110-utmi.o: in function `mvebu_cp110_utmi_phy_probe':
phy-mvebu-cp110-utmi.c:(.text+0x152): undefined reference to `of_usb_get_dr_mode_by_phy'

---
 drivers/phy/marvell/Kconfig |    2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

--- linux-next-20210331.orig/drivers/phy/marvell/Kconfig
+++ linux-next-20210331/drivers/phy/marvell/Kconfig
@@ -70,7 +70,7 @@ config PHY_MVEBU_CP110_COMPHY
 config PHY_MVEBU_CP110_UTMI
 	tristate "Marvell CP110 UTMI driver"
 	depends on ARCH_MVEBU || COMPILE_TEST
-	depends on OF
+	depends on OF && USB_COMMON
 	select GENERIC_PHY
 	help
 	  Enable this to support Marvell CP110 UTMI PHY driver.
